In 2023, Finland led the European export of rosin and resin acids, with notable volume growth of 0.28%. Portugal experienced a complete halt in exports, while Denmark saw significant growth at 23.89%. Greece managed a positive performance with a 4.9% increase. In contrast, countries like Estonia and Cyprus observed sharp declines of 20.92% and 21.93%, respectively. France and Germany also registered negative growth, reflecting competitive market dynamics.

Top countries in Export of Rosin and Resin Acids and Derivatives, Rosin Spirit and Oils, Run Gums by Country
| # | 10 Countries | Kilograms | Last Year | YoY | 5-years CAGR |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| 1 Finland | 56,026,000 | 2023 | +2.13% | +0.28% | View data |
| 2 | 2 Portugal | 54,560,000 | 2023 | -2.1% | View data | |
| 3 | 3 Sweden | 49,785,000 | 2023 | +8.05% | -1.62% | View data |
| 4 | 4 Netherlands | 45,432,000 | 2023 | +3.78% | +0.14% | View data |
| 5 | 5 France | 28,321,000 | 2023 | -1.4% | -4.21% | View data |
| 6 | 6 Spain | 21,043,000 | 2023 | +4.17% | -0.00014% | View data |
| 7 | 7 Austria | 9,367,200 | 2023 | +1.31% | +1.04% | View data |
| 8 | 8 Greece | 7,159,000 | 2023 | +1.95% | +4.9% | View data |
| 9 | 9 Belgium | 7,131,400 | 2023 | -51.77% | View data | |
| 10 | 10 Germany | 7,030,000 | 2023 | -5.69% | -4.03% | View data |
